Redis队列——PHP操作简单示例
2024-10-01 02:50:15
入队操作
<?php
$redis = new Redis();
$redis->connect('127.0.0.1',6379);
while(True){
try{
$value = 'value_'.date('Y-m-d H:i:s');
$redis->LPUSH('key1',$value);
sleep(rand()%3);
echo $value."\n";
}catch(Exception $e){
echo $e->getMessage()."\n";
}
}
?> 出队操作
<?php
$redis = new Redis();
$redis->pconnect('127.0.0.1',6379);
while(True){
try{
echo $redis->LPOP('key1')."\n";
}catch(Exception $e){
echo $e->getMessage()."\n";
}
sleep(rand()%3);
}
?>
最新文章
- 安装yum
- 利用Lambda获取属性名称
- Codeforces 13C Sequence --DP+离散化
- cogs896 圈奶牛
- Python变量类型
- Hadoop 问题 &; 解决
- 430的启动,I/O中断
- JavaScript---网络编程(4)-Date、Math、Global和自定义对象
- 一个测ip和端口是否联通的工具类
- How To Configure VMware fencing using fence_vmware_soap in RHEL High Availability Add On(RHEL Pacemaker中配置STONITH)
- Elasticsearch——起步
- angular 实现 echarts 拖动区域进行放大 方法
- django数据查询之聚合查询和分组查询
- Mac 的mysql5.7没有配置文件,如何解决only_full_group_by 问题
- JQuery 获取多个select标签option的text内容
- Firefox 功能笔记
- Python-使用PyQT生成图形界面
- Angular 6.X CLI(Angular.json) 属性详解
- lambda表达式学习
- Java基础(七):重写与重载
热门文章
- uboot 版本号生成过程
- 自定义Git【转】
- Linux环境下如何配置IP地址、MAC地址
- codeforces 256 div2 C. Painting Fence 分治
- [osg][osgearth]osg的分页加载,代码和结构图
- MySQL查询in操作排序
- C#正则_取出标签内的内容(非贪婪)
- 转-Linux启动过程详解(inittab、rc.sysinit、rcX.d、rc.local)
- 在小红家里面,有n组开关,触摸每个开关,可以使得一组灯泡点亮。
- 安装完Linux Mint后,发现系统中竟没有中文输入法